Finding the Right Roofing Contractor: What to Look For

Securing a trustworthy home company can feel overwhelming, but careful due diligence is essential for a successful project. Start by requesting several estimates from local companies. Verify their license with your state's official department and examine for any previous complaints with the Better Business Bureau. Do not hesitate to ask references and contact them to understand the firm’s track record. Finally, a clear agreement outlining the work, duration, and expense is crucial to minimize potential issues.
